Our client in Kitchener, is looking for a Production Manager to join the team in a full-time permanent role!

The ideal candidate will have 3-5 years of experience in production / plant management in a manufacturing and solid leadership skills!

If you are the successful candidate, you will be the recipient of a a competitive salary at 80K per year as well as full benefits plan, RSP matching and paid vacation time!

Job Responsibilities :

  • Develop positive attitudes and teamwork
  • Train operators that are running automatic machines to perform complete quality inspection and documentation
  • Improve quality by ensuring daily quality inspections are completed at beginning and end of shift with quality technician and inspectors
  • Training of Shift Leaders, Production employees, Process / Tool Room, Set-up, and Maintenance
  • Support and develop company objectives of Safety, Quality and Productivity
  • Continual improvement within quality department
  • Set daily priorities and develop an efficient daily plan
  • Ensure a safe working environment by providing staff with the resources to complete their work safely and efficiently
  • Understand and train staff on the ISO program
  • Coordinating production in order of priorities and improving plant efficiency
  • Develop a training and mentoring program
  • Work with our team to develop KanBan system for all raw and finished goods including a plan to manage material overflow
  • Implement use of standard process sheets and standardized shift performance reporting
  • Lead, implement, and document continuous improvement solutions identified from performance monitoring.
  • Participate in Monthly Non-Conformance and Defect Tracking Meetings
  • Participate with Product Development Group as part of new project launch
  • Monitor daily shift performance report to investigate output anomalies

Required Skills :

  • 3-5+ years experience in production management, preferably in injection molding
  • Excellent supervision and leadership skills
  • Superior communications skills with the ability to motivate staff to be productive
  • Set-up and processing capabilities
  • Ability to manage staff, set priorities, assign tasks efficiently, meet production goals
  • Experience reporting production results.
